LDOS PhD Research School

Advances in Learned Systems

Join us for the inaugural PhD Research School event hosted by the Learning Directed Operating System Expedition. This event explores the fields of operating systems, networked systems, machine learning, formal methods, and security, bringing together experts and early-career researchers to discuss the latest advancements and challenges in these domains.

Over the course of two days, participants will engage in a focused program that includes tutorials, lectures, and research presentations. The event will feature research presentations from leading experts in the field, allowing attendees to deepen their understanding of cutting-edge research.
